I think u should work more on your 3d "understanding". U want to hack your brain for visualize everything u draw in 3d before drawing it. It's the first assignement of Marc and a very important one. Drew box / cylinder / cone in every perespective possible, intersect them / try to shade them in multiple angle. Those basics form are our building blocks. With this blocks we can build everything. Before trying to figure out what's the anatomy figure out what are the primary building blocks and the proportion between them.
